It's inability to provide and maintain proper WEB2 sites (i.e more than one post and full user details/bio etc) means that this aspect is a monumental fail.
The one post sites from 2008 will not work in 2011. The sitre owners delete them as quick as they can - and those they miss are routinely ignored by the SE's.
Self serving 1-2 post mini sites are dead. They were dying slowly then "panda" killed them completely.
Without web2 functionality improved to cover this the benefits of X are very limited. A decent RSS tool, bookmaarking tool and article submission tool would not take more time to learn than these items in X - and you could buy the lot - with a good keyword tool - for less than 2 months subs and never have to pay another penny.
Not only that they would be demonstrably BETTER.

Nuke X's main tenet is the WEB2 creation and submission. With this feature stuck in 2008 I think it is a fail.

Google and the WEB2 owners between them have tightened up A LOT in the past 24-36 months,

The WEB2 sites don't want self promotion posts and are actively making it as hard as possible to keep accounts open and are deleting the obvious self promotion stuff as soon as it sees it. Then Google is not giving you any credit even for those that DO stay open.

I used my free subs to put up a load in early May and got some short term gains, but the links are fading and being deleted quick. Had sign up and submission problems as well even with brand new tools as the WEB2 sites change the sign up and submit process VERY frequently and often in extremely subtle ways (so a normal user would hardly notice, but a posting bot falls over)

The tools available now are stuck in 2008. I've checked maybe 7 or 8 in the past 3 months, and although there is still some minor benefit in using them, the hassle of keeping on top of sign ups and the waste of good content thrown into these trash generating engines makes the process pretty much a waste of time.

WEB 2 owners don't want to get hit by an algorithm change so they are raising the stakes, and the automated web2 tools - all of them - are a generation behind.
